About the role
Moog’s Gilbert AZ facility is a leading designer of spaceflight hardware and is a part of the Spacecraft Avionics business unit in the Space & Defense Group. Moog has partnered with NASA to provide electronic solutions for the Artemis Orion Crew Capsule, Viper Lunar Rover, Satellite Laser Communications Relay, OSIRIS-REX to study asteroid composition along with complete satellite buses for the defense department.
Responsibilities
- Serve as lead responsible engineer and technical point of contact to customers on design, development, and production of custom space electronics.
- Provide effective project leadership to cross-functional and cross-site engineering teams for development / qualification / production programs.
- Assign tasks to team members. Review work product for technical accuracy.
- Manage budget, schedule, risk, and technical execution for development and production projects for which you are responsible. Actively manage scope creep.
- Manage product requirements from internal and external customer stakeholders through product development evolution including deriving design and test requirements necessary to ensure product performance, functionality, reliability and manufacturability.
- Collaborate with designers to validate conceptual solutions through the performance of trade studies and analyses. Allocate product requirements to functional disciplines and coordinate the verification activities across the project team to ensure all product requirements are verified and documented.
- Author and review engineering analyses and reports. Ensure project data deliverables meet customer specifications and are delivered on time.
- Author test procedures. Assist in design verification testing and production hardware testing.
- Read and understand printed circuit board assembly (PCBA) schematics. Use laboratory measurement equipment to diagnose and troubleshoot electronic failures down to the discrete component / integrated circuit level.
- Resolve non-conformance issue encountered during manufacturing and testing activities including leading Failure Review Board (FRB) meetings and championing Root Cause and Corrective Action (RCCA) efforts.
- Assign tasks to and review the work of system engineering, product engineers and other lead engineers and provide mentorship to junior engineers.
